Description of the Area/Topic of Research 

The research topic is water pollution, predominately focussing on how to monitor and model the risks that water pollution poses to human life. The rich sources and transport pathways in water catchments result in a complex problem that the Canada Excellence in Research Chair (CERC) in Waterborne Pathogens: Surveillance, Prediction and Mitigation aims to address through surveillance, modelling and mitigation. 
This postdoctoral scholar will develop their expertise in the monitoring or modelling of water pollution in areas such as: (1) water sensing to enhance our ability to monitor water pollution at high spatial and temporal resolution through low cost IoT devices, (2) developing novel sensors or sampling systems to detect a wider range of pollutants of concern to public health, OR (3) developing models that include the real time control of assets to optimise the performance of our water system. 

Description of Area

The postdoctoral scholar will work together in a large team together with the Canada Excellence in Research Chair (CERC) in Waterborne Pathogens: Surveillance, Prediction and Mitigation. This team will innovate, develop and validate novel sampling and sensing methods, rapid diagnostic tools, integrated models and treatment options for the surveillance, prediction and mitigation of waterborne pathogens via five deliverables: (1) smart sampling and sensing systems to detect temporal and spatial trends of pathogens in water systems, (2) rapid and near-real-time assays to detect pathogens and their sources, (3) tools/models that can provide early warning of, and mitigation options to limit, disease in our community, (4) treatment of pathogens to protect human health when water is used by humans and (5) training, standard operating procedures, reference materials and guidance manuals to ensure our outputs are useful and adopted by our partners.
